The shift toward digital therapy has opened doors for couples who previously felt hesitant, uncomfortable, or too busy for in-person sessions. Some benefits include:
Online therapy allows couples to schedule sessions around busy routines. No travel time, no waiting rooms — just immediate access to support.
Being at home can help partners communicate more openly, especially about emotional topics.
Online sessions can reduce costs related to commuting, childcare, or scheduling conflicts.
Winnipeg residents can connect with trained professionals regardless of neighbourhood or distance.
Online counselling offers confidentiality while reducing hesitation or stigma.

Both formats are effective, and research supports online therapy as equally beneficial for many couples. However, online therapy offers unique advantages for Winnipeg residents during extreme weather, demanding work schedules, or family-related obligations.
In-person sessions may still be preferred by couples who value physical presence, body language observation, or structured office settings. Ultimately, the choice depends on comfort and goals — and online therapy provides flexibility without compromising support.

1. Is online couples therapy effective?
Yes. Many couples experience significant improvements in communication, emotional connection, and problem-solving through online counselling.
2. How long does therapy take?
Every couple is different. Some benefit within a few sessions, while others continue over months for deeper transformation.
3. Do sessions involve both partners?
Typically, yes. But therapists may include occasional individual sessions when needed.
4. Is counselling only for couples in crisis?
Not at all. Counselling is equally useful for relationship strengthening, premarital guidance, and everyday communication improvements.
